Nanjing Food---Vegetarian Buns of Lvliuju

 


绿柳居的素菜包 


Vegetarian Buns of LvliujuVegetarian Bun of Lvliuju Restaurant is famously known as one of the best snacks of China. The husk, or called the skin of the delicacy is made from leavened refined wheat flour, and the stuffing contains tiny green vegetable which is a specialty in the south of Yangtze River, Chinese black mushrooms, bamboo shoots, dried bean curd pieces, sesames and needle mushrooms (金针菇). More vegetarian ingredients are to be added into the buns sometimes according to tastes.

A legend goes that when the last candidate attained first grade at the imperial examination in the Qing Dynasty and China's famous entrepreneur, Zhang Qian (张骞), was traveling in Nanjing, he accidentally found the preparation method of this vegetarian bun and told to the locally well-known Lvliuju Restaurant, and renamed it as Lvliuju Vegetarian Bun. Dr. Sun Yat-sen, the great democratic revolutionist and founding father of modern China, had once tasted this delicious snack, and he favored it very much. Since then, Vegetarian Buns of Lvliuju have been widely popular in Nanjing.
